How do you make a frustum of a cone?
How to construct a frustum? If you cut off the top part of a cone with a plane perpendicular to the height of the cone, you obtain a conical frustum. See figure on the left: the upper base of the frustum has radius r and the lower base has radius R. The height of the frustum is h.
How to calculate the surface area of a conical frustum?
Volume of a conical frustum: V = (1/3) * π * h * (r 1 2 + r 2 2 + (r 1 * r 2)) Lateral surface area of a conical frustum: S = π * (r 1 + r 2) * s = π * (r 1 + r 2) * √((r 1 – r 2) 2 + h 2) Top surface area of a conical frustum (a circle): T = πr 1 2. Base surface area of a conical frustum (a circle): B = πr 2 2.

What does the word frustum mean in Latin?
Frustum is a Latin word which means ‘piece cut off’. When a solid (generally a cone or a pyramid) is cut in such a manner that base of the solid and the plane cutting the solid are parallel to each other, part of solid which remains between the parallel cutting plane and the base is known as frustum of that solid.
